Biological Role:
plant hormone  A plant growth regulator that modulates the formation of stems, leaves and flowers, as well as the development and ripening of fruit. The term includes endogenous and non-endogenous compounds (e.g. active compounds produced by bacteria on the leaf surface) as well as semi-synthetic and fully synthetic compounds.
